Form 4: Director Joseph Loscalzo Executes Stock Options at Ionis
Statement of Changes in Beneficial Ownership
Ionis Pharmaceuticals Director Joseph Loscalzo exercised stock options and sold 77,289 shares under a Rule 10b5-1 trading plan.
Summary
- Director Joseph Loscalzo exercised options for 77,289 shares of Ionis Pharmaceuticals common stock on May 4, 2026.
- The exercise prices for these options ranged from $38.06 to $64.80 per share.
- Following the exercise, the director sold the acquired shares in two tranches at weighted average prices of $74.90 and $75.58 per share.
- The transactions were executed pursuant to a Rule 10b5-1 trading plan adopted on November 18, 2025.

Negatives
- The director reduced his direct beneficial ownership of Ionis Pharmaceuticals common stock from 113,619 shares to 36,330 shares following the sales.
